National Law Enforcement Roadway Safety Program (NLERSP) Information

This document explains opportunities available from the National Law Enforcement Roadway Safety Program (NLERSP), which provides no-cost training, technical assistance, and resources to local, state, and tribal law enforcement agencies with the goal of reducing the number of officers injured and killed on the nation’s roadways. Further information is available at LEOroadwaysafety.org.

Please Slow Down - US Police Officers Killed While Working on Road in 2024

This PSA produced by the John Petropoulos Memorial Fund highlights Slow Down Move Over as an effective way to reduce the number of law enforcement officers struck and killed on U.S. roadways every year. In 2024, 24 U.S. law enforcement officers were struck and killed while assisting motorists on the roadway. These 24 officers are honored by name in the PSA.
